Hunting and Fishing do a line of black synthetic ones the larger one is not to bad at all reasonable price good zips 3 pockets one big enough for a suppressor - there is a smaller model with just one small pocket - well worth a look - more than happy with mine
Allen gun cases. They have a confusing array of models at varying price points, but they seem well built with proper zips. I think we've got 5 different ones in the family now.
Went to them after getting tired of the zips failing on the cheapies, or the lining fraying and getting caught in the zip from the inside. No complaints with these.

Check out the soft bags for Tikka rifles - though branded T3 or Tikka on the bags, are a good fit with rifles with big scopes like my 4x12x50. Also appear to have a sturdy side zip pouch that fits the suppressor/bolt/mag etc. I have had my first T3 rifle bag (originals were green) for about 12 yrs now, still going strong. Brought another one last year for a second rifle (bags now black/orange).

I have a few from Nz outdoor gear as others have suggested good heavy duty canvas or pvc, bloody good. Don’t waste your $ on the branded rubbish from the big hunting stores. Every single one I’ve had in the past has fallen apart in some way, broken zips, stitching giving way, handles breaking etc etc
They’ll make whatever size you want, $100.
I prefer the green canvas but the pvc floats….
